Nalco 3272 is a specialized chemical treatment used primarily for boiler water systems to prevent corrosion and scale. It is typically supplied as a powder or concentrated solid. Proper handling requires strict adherence to its Safety Data Sheet (SDS) to mitigate risks associated with its alkaline and sulfite-based composition. 1. Key Chemical Composition

According to the MSDS, Nalco 3272 contains two primary active ingredients:

Sodium Carbonate (30–80%): Used for alkalinity control and pH adjustment to protect metal surfaces.

Sodium Sulfite (10–30%): Functions as an oxygen scavenger to prevent pitting corrosion in boiler systems. 2. Safety and Hazard Identification

Exposure to Nalco 3272 can lead to several health and physical risks:

Eye & Skin Contact: Can cause moderate to serious irritation.

Inhalation: Dust generation may irritate mucous membranes or trigger asthmatic reactions in sensitive individuals. nalco 3272 msds install

Ingestion: Though unlikely, it may cause nausea, vomiting, or severe allergic reactions in sulfite-sensitive persons. Physical Hazards: Contact with acids liberates toxic gas. 3. Personal Protective Equipment (PPE)

When handling or "installing" the product into a treatment workflow, the following PPE is recommended: Eyes: Chemical splash goggles or a full face shield. Hands: Gloves made of PVC, nitrile, or neoprene.

Skin: Standard protective clothing such as long sleeves and chemical-resistant aprons.

Ventilation: Use local exhaust ventilation if dust or mists are generated during the mixing process. 4. Handling and Storage Requirements

Storage: Store in original, tightly closed, and labeled containers in a dry area at room temperature (

Incompatibilities: Avoid contact with acids, as this can trigger the release of toxic fumes.

Spill Response: For small spills, sweep up and shovel the material into recovery drums; for liquid residues, use absorbent material. Avoid washing residues into sewers or public waterways. 5. Installation and Application Guide

Nalco 3272 is a chemical treatment primarily used for boiler water treatment

. It is designed to act as an oxygen scavenger and pH adjuster to prevent corrosion and scaling within industrial boiler systems.

Below is a drafted technical overview covering the safety, handling, and application of Nalco 3272 based on available Material Safety Data Sheet (MSDS) information. 1. Product Identification and Composition

Nalco 3272 is typically supplied as a powder or concentrated solid. Its primary active hazardous components include: Sodium Carbonate (30–80%) : Used for alkalinity control and pH adjustment. Sodium Sulfite (10–30%) : Acts as an oxygen scavenger to prevent pitting corrosion. 2. Hazard Identification Eye Contact : Causes serious eye irritation. Skin Contact

: May cause mild irritation or allergic reactions in sensitive individuals. Inhalation

: Dust generation can cause respiratory tract irritation. It may trigger asthmatic-like symptoms in hyper-reactive individuals due to the sulfite content. Physical/Chemical Hazards : Contact with strong acids can liberate toxic sulfur dioxide gas 3. Safe Handling and Installation

When "installing" or introducing Nalco 3272 into a system, follow these safety protocols: Ventilation

: Use local exhaust ventilation if dust or mists are generated.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) : Chemical splash goggles or a face shield. : PVC, nitrile, or neoprene gloves. : Standard protective clothing (long sleeves, aprons). Respiratory

: Not normally needed unless dust is generated; in such cases, use an approved dust respirator. Application

: The product is typically dosed into the boiler feed water or deaerator storage tank. Ensure the system is compatible with plastic materials if using automated feed equipment. 4. Storage and Disposal

: Keep containers tightly closed in a cool, dry area. Store away from incompatible materials

such as strong acids (e.g., sulfuric or nitric acid) and strong oxidizers.

: Sweep up dry material and shovel into recovery drums. Avoid using water immediately, as wet product creates extremely slippery floor conditions.

: Dispose of in accordance with local, state, and federal regulations. 5. First Aid Measures

: Flush immediately with plenty of water for at least 15 minutes. : Wash with soap and water; remove contaminated clothing.

: Do not induce vomiting. Seek medical attention if symptoms occur. Inhalation : Move to fresh air.
